BiddingStrategy

Настройки, управляющие стратегией назначения ставок. Стратегия ставок определяет цену предложения.

JSON-представление
{

  // Union field bid_strategy_scheme can be only one of the following:
  "fixedBid": {
    object (FixedBidStrategy)
  },
  "maximizeSpendAutoBid": {
    object (MaximizeSpendBidStrategy)
  },
  "performanceGoalAutoBid": {
    object (PerformanceGoalBidStrategy)
  }
  // End of list of possible types for union field bid_strategy_scheme.
}
Поля
Поле объединения bid_strategy_scheme . Необходимый. bid_strategy_scheme может быть только одним из следующих:
fixedBid

object ( FixedBidStrategy )

Стратегия, использующая фиксированную цену предложения.

maximizeSpendAutoBid

object ( MaximizeSpendBidStrategy )

Стратегия, которая автоматически корректирует ставку в соответствии с вашей целью по эффективности, расходуя при этом весь бюджет.

На уровне заказа на размещение для параметра markupType позиций нельзя установить значение PARTNER_REVENUE_MODEL_MARKUP_TYPE_CPM . Кроме того, если performanceGoalType имеет одно из следующих значений:

  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PA
  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PC
  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_AV_VIEWED ,

lineItemType позиций заказа на размещение должен иметь одно из следующих значений:

  • LINE_ITEM_TYPE_DISPLAY_DEFAULT
  • LINE_ITEM_TYPE_VIDEO_DEFAULT ,

и когда performanceGoalType имеет значение:

  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CIVA
  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_IVO_TEN

lineItemType позиций заказа на размещение должен иметь значение LINE_ITEM_TYPE_VIDEO_DEFAULT .

performanceGoalAutoBid

object ( PerformanceGoalBidStrategy )

Стратегия, которая автоматически корректирует ставку для достижения или превышения заданной цели по эффективности. Его следует использовать только для объекта отдельной позиции.

Стратегия фиксированных ставок

Стратегия, использующая фиксированную цену торгов.

JSON-представление
{
  "bidAmountMicros": string
}
Поля
bidAmountMicros

string ( int64 format)

Фиксированная сумма ставки в микронах валюты рекламодателя. Для сущности заказа на размещение bidAmountMicros должно быть установлено равным 0. Для сущности позиции bidAmountMicros должна быть больше или равна оплачиваемой единице в заданной валюте и меньше или равна верхнему пределу 1000000000.

Например, 1500000 представляет собой 1,5 стандартных единицы валюты.

Стратегия MaximizeSpendBid

Стратегия, которая автоматически корректирует ставку для оптимизации заданной цели по эффективности при расходовании полного бюджета.

JSON-представление
{
  "performanceGoalType": enum (BiddingStrategyPerformanceGoalType),
  "maxAverageCpmBidAmountMicros": string,
  "raiseBidForDeals": boolean,
  "customBiddingAlgorithmId": string
}
Поля
performanceGoalType

enum ( BiddingStrategyPerformanceGoalType )

Необходимый. Тип цели по эффективности, которую стратегия назначения ставок пытается свести к минимуму при расходовании всего бюджета. B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_VIEWABLE_CPM не поддерживается для этой стратегии.

maxAverageCpmBidAmountMicros

string ( int64 format)

Максимальная средняя цена за тысячу показов, которую можно назначить, в микронах валюты рекламодателя. Должно быть больше или равно оплачиваемой единице данной валюты.

Например, 1500000 представляет собой 1,5 стандартных единицы валюты.

raiseBidForDeals

boolean

Учитывает ли стратегия минимальные цены сделок.

customBiddingAlgorithmId

string ( int64 format)

Идентификатор специального алгоритма назначения ставок, используемого этой стратегией. Применимо только в том случае, если для performanceGoalType установлено знач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CUSTOM_ALGO .

Стратегия назначения ставокЭффективностьТип цели

Возможные типы целей эффективности для стратегии назначения ставок.

Перечисления
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_UNSPECIFIED Значение типа не указано или неизвестно в этой версии.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PA Стоимость за действие.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PC Стоимость клика.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_VIEWABLE_CPM Видимая цена за тысячу показов.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CUSTOM_ALGO Пользовательский алгоритм назначения ставок.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CIVA Завершенный обзор и звуковые представления.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_IVO_TEN Время просмотра более 10 секунд.
B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_AV_VIEWED Видимые показы.

ПроизводительностьЦельСтратегия ставок

Стратегия, которая автоматически корректирует ставку для достижения или превышения заданной цели по эффективности.

JSON-представление
{
  "performanceGoalType": enum (BiddingStrategyPerformanceGoalType),
  "performanceGoalAmountMicros": string,
  "maxAverageCpmBidAmountMicros": string,
  "customBiddingAlgorithmId": string
}
Поля
performanceGoalType

enum ( BiddingStrategyPerformanceGoalType )

Необходимый. Тип цели по эффективности, которую стратегия назначения ставок будет пытаться достичь или превзойти.

Для использования на уровне позиции значение должно быть одним из:

  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PA
  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PC
  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_VIEWABLE_CPM
  • B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CUSTOM_ALGO .
performanceGoalAmountMicros

string ( int64 format)

Необходимый. Цель эффективности, которую стратегия назначения ставок будет пытаться достичь или превзойти, выражается в микромах валюты рекламодателя или в микрозначениях ROAS (рентабельности расходов на рекламу), которая также зависит от валюты рекламодателя. Должно быть больше или равно расчетной единице данной валюты и меньше или равно верхним границам. У каждого performanceGoalType есть верхняя граница:

  • если performanceGoalType установлено B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PA , верхняя граница составляет 10 000,00 долларов США.
  • если performanceGoalType имеет знач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CPC , верхняя граница составляет 1000,00 долларов США.
  • если performanceGoalType имеет знач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_VIEWABLE_CPM , верхняя граница составляет 1000,00 долларов США.
  • если performanceGoalType имеет знач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CUSTOM_ALGO , верхняя граница равна 1000,00, а нижняя граница – 0,01.

Пример. Если установлено знач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_VIEWABLE_CPM , цена ставки будет основываться на вероятности того, что каждый доступный показ будет доступен для просмотра. Например, если целевая цена за тысячу показов в видимой области экрана составляет 2 доллара США, а вероятность показа в видимой области экрана составляет 40 %, то цена предложения составит 0,80 доллара США за тысячу показов (40 % от 2 долларов США).

Например, 1500000 представляет собой 1,5 стандартных единицы валюты или значения рентабельности инвестиций в рекламу.

maxAverageCpmBidAmountMicros

string ( int64 format)

Максимальная средняя цена за тысячу показов, которую можно назначить, в микронах валюты рекламодателя. Должно быть больше или равно оплачиваемой единице данной валюты. Неприменимо, если для performanceGoalType установлено знач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_VIEWABLE_CPM .

Например, 1500000 представляет собой 1,5 стандартных единицы валюты.

customBiddingAlgorithmId

string ( int64 format)

Идентификатор специального алгоритма назначения ставок, используемого этой стратегией. Применимо только в том случае, если для performanceGoalType установлено значение BIDDING_STRATEGY_PERFORMANCE_GOAL_TYPE_CUSTOM_ALGO .